Transaction 251d55785cd43919fe3e0484bee78d9900f2ced626962325bd30571ee8bdf223

1 Input
2 Outputs
  • 251d55785cd43919fe3e0484bee78d9900f2ced626962325bd30571ee8bdf223:0
  • value  9092855578
    address  16CXKyaFgVzyKSREXTGTw9PH5H7iqUdu4D
  • 251d55785cd43919fe3e0484bee78d9900f2ced626962325bd30571ee8bdf223:1
  • value  72500000
    address  15xjXJHSg2VxqCr2K7Xv4mcLQrcBx5CcsA